Calypso Grilled Pineapple

Servings: 8 Difficulty: Intermediate
Tropical grilled pineapple wedges glazed with a rich, spiced rum and brown butter sauce.

This vibrant dessert brings the taste of the islands to your backyard grill. Fresh pineapple wedges are brushed with a complex sauce made from butter, brown sugar, honey, and dark rum, then grilled until caramelized and charred. The heat brings out the natural sweetness of the fruit while adding a smoky depth that pairs perfectly with the tangy Worcestershire note. It’s an easy, elegant way to end a summer dinner party or a casual barbecue. Serve war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ream for a striking contrast of hot and cold textures.

Directions

  1. Combine Worcestershire sauce, honey, butter, brown sugar, and dark rum in a medium saucepan.
  2. Bring the mixture to a full boil over medium-high heat, stirring frequently to dissolve the sugar.
  3.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er for 12 minutes, stirring often, until the sauce is slightly thickened.
  4. Remove the sauce from heat and allow it to cool completely.
  5.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at and oil the grates to prevent sticking.
  6. Brush the pineapple wedges generously with some of the cooled rum sauce.
  7. Place the pineapple wedges on the grill.
  8. Grill for about 5 minutes, turning and basting frequently with the remaining sauce until the fruit is glazed and has char marks.
  9. Serve the warm grilled pineapple wedges alongside a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
  10. Drizzle with the leftover sauce and garnish as desired.
